UPDATE 1-Storms knock out power for 200,000 in US Midwest/Gulf
December 20, 2012 at 08:27 AM EST
Dec 20 (Reuters) - A series of storms knocked out power for over 200,000 customers in the U.S. Midwest and Gulf Coast, power companies said on Thursday. The storms have also caused tornadoes in the Mobile, Alabama, area, according to weather forecaster AccuWeather.com. The following is a list of some of the regions affected by the storms.
